Non-targeted analysis of whisky using SPME Arrow and Orbitrap Exploris GC 240 mass spectrometer

This study demonstrates the use of Orbitrap high-resolution accurate mass spectrometry and the HS-SPME method. The chemical composition of whiskies was characterized to detect differences between distilleries and identify markers of counterfeit products, ensuring product integrity.

The Thermo Scientific Orbitrap Exploris and Excedion series mass spectrometers are Orbitrap instruments with an atmospheric pressure ionization (API) source for liquid chromatography (LC) mass spectrometry (MS) high-throughput applications. The instruments are designed to be placed on a bench in the laboratory and maintain mass accuracy across chromatographic peaks, supporting confident identification and quantitation using high-resolution accurate-mass detection.
